TALLADEGA, Ala. (AP) – Kasey Kahne has won the pole at Talladega Superspeedway, the fourth race in NASCAR’s Chase for the Sprint Cup championship.
Kahne’s lap of 191.455 mph earned him the top starting spot for Sunday’s race. Ryan Newman qualified second with a lap at 191.145, giving Chevrolet a sweep of the front row.
Two-time defending race winner Clint Bowyer qualified third and was surprised by the strong run. He said he expected to qualify poorly, and the good starting spot will force him to change his race strategy.
Three-time NASCAR champion Tony Stewart qualified fourth, and Greg Biffle was fifth to put four Chase drivers in the top five.
Jeff Gordon, Carl Edwards, Trevor Bayne, Martin Truex Jr. and Sam Hornish Jr. rounded out the top 10.
